Festo DSNU Series Pneumatic Piston Rod Cylinder, 150mm Stroke, 12mm Bore - DSNU-S-12-150-P-A-MQ, Numeric Part Number:5211909
This pneumatic piston rod cylinder provides reliable operation across a variety of industrial applications. Designed as a double-acting mechanism, it features a stroke length of 150mm and a bore diameter of 12mm, making it suitable for various tasks in automation and mechanical systems. With a length of 59.1mm, this cylinder meets ISO standards and is constructed to resist moderate corrosion, ensuring longevity in demanding environments.
Features & Benefits
• Double-acting design enables efficient operation in both directions
• M5 pneumatic connection simplifies integration with existing systems
• High-pressure capability up to 10 bar for robust performance
• Cleanroom class 5 compatibility allows use in sensitive environments
• Lubricated operation is possible for improved performance longevity

What operating pressure range does this cylinder support?
It supports an operating pressure from 0.15 MPa to 1.0 MPa, translating to 1.5 bar to 10 bar. This flexibility allows it to be used across various applications requiring different pressure levels.
How does the cushioning feature enhance performance?
The elastic cushioning rings absorb energy at both ends of the stroke, reducing wear and tear on the piston and prolonging the cylinders lifespan while ensuring smooth operation.
Can the cylinder be reliably used in outdoor environments?
While it is rated for moderate corrosion resistance, it is best suited for controlled environments. For outdoor use, additional protective measures may be necessary to extend its functional lifespan.
